package utility.module;
import java.io.File;
import java.nio.file.Path;
import java.util.HashSet;
import java.util.Set;
import java.util.function.Predicate;
import generic.jar.ResourceFile;
import ghidra.framework.GModule;
/**
* A predicate used to filter modules using the classpath. Only modules included in the classpath
* will pass this filter. Any modules not on the classpath may be included by calling
* {@link #ClasspathFilter(Predicate)} with a predicate that allows other module paths.
*/
public class ClasspathFilter implements Predicate<GModule> {
private Predicate<Path> additionalPaths = p -> false;
private Set<Path> cpModulePaths = new HashSet<>();
/**
* Default constructor to allow only modules on the classpath.
*/
public ClasspathFilter() {
String cp = System.getProperty("java.class.path");
String[] cpPathStrings = cp.split(File.pathSeparator);
for (String cpPathString : cpPathStrings) {
Path modulePath = ModuleUtilities.getModule(cpPathString);
if (modulePath != null) {
Path normalized = modulePath.normalize().toAbsolutePath();
cpModulePaths.add(normalized);
}
}
}
/**
* Constructor that allows any module to be included whose path passed the given predicate. If
* the predicate returns false, then a given module will only be included if it is in the
* classpath.
*
* @param additionalPaths a predicate that allows additional module paths (they do not need to
* be on the system classpath)
*/
public ClasspathFilter(Predicate<Path> additionalPaths) {
this();
this.additionalPaths = additionalPaths;
}
@Override
public boolean test(GModule m) {
ResourceFile file = m.getModuleRoot();
Path path = Path.of(file.getAbsolutePath());
Path normalized = path.normalize().toAbsolutePath();
return additionalPaths.test(normalized) || cpModulePaths.contains(normalized);
}
}
